support listening on unix domain sockets

This trivial patch addresses bug 1639. When a bind_to_address argument starts with a slash, assume that it is the address of a Unix domain socket. git-svn-id: https://svn.musicpd.org/mpd/trunk@7235 09075e82-0dd4-0310-85a5-a0d7c8717e4f
